The 60-day election period is 60 days from the later of (a) the date they send you the COBRA election notice or (b) the last day of your coverage under the plan. If your last day of coverage was September 30, you still have time to elect within the 60-day period. Tell them you don't have the election materials, that you want them NOW, so that you can make a timely election on their forms within the 60-day election period. Follow that up with a letter saying the same thing. Send it certified mail, with return receipt requested. In the letter also say that you are electing COBRA for yourself and your family memembers (so you've elected it anyway), and that you want a statement of the required premiums and when they are due. Make a photocopy of everything you send.
Finally, complain NOW to the U.S. Department of Labor, Employee Benefit Security Administration. You can find the telephone number for the nearesr office of the EBSA at the Department's website: www.dol.gov/ebsa. Tell them exactly what's happened, and give them a name and a phone number they can call at the employer or plan. Do that today, don't wait.
